Output d93605bfed05c3d8f93129ef29595ee7758100ad5261fb18654d73ce46e6c614:1

value
335413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ac5b37b8777ad49a098a283d33be30c24e1d9a6 OP_EQUAL
address
35bB97aBvUTWAJQVx3DrDbZW61KsFYSkjS
transaction
d93605bfed05c3d8f93129ef29595ee7758100ad5261fb18654d73ce46e6c614
spent
true